University of Dundee, founded in 1881 and independent since 1967, is a public research university in Dundee, Scotland, ranked #447 in the QS World University Rankings 2027. The university enrolls over 23,800 students, with international enrolment at around 25%, and holds particular strength in life sciences, dentistry, and design.

Dundee University offers more than 200 taught postgraduate and undergraduate programmes, all delivered in English, spanning medicine, dentistry, engineering, business, computing, law, and the arts. Indian applicants can enter through the primary September 2027 intake and a smaller January 2027 intake for selected masters, with the university listing 26 authorised recruitment partners across India as per the official India country page.

Dundee University runs a partial-fee scholarship framework, with tuition-linked awards ranging from GBP 1,500 to GBP 10,000 per year and no fully funded routes. Indian applicants can layer the GREAT Scholarship, the Vice Chancellor’s South Asia Scholarship, and the Global Excellence Scholarship against their tuition. Post-study, graduates qualify for the two-year UK Graduate Route work visa, giving Indian students a clear pathway to convert study into employment in Scotland.

University of Dundee Admission Requirements for Indian Applicants 2027

University of Dundee admission requirements for Indian students are grade-based, English-tested, and course-specific, with clear India equivalencies published on the official India page.

PG Requirements

  • Academic: Bachelor’s degree with 55% to 60% or CGPA 5.5 to 6.0/10 for most MSc programmes (recommended); higher for competitive routes.
  • English proficiency: IELTS Academic 6.5 overall with no band below 6.0 for most masters; verify course-specific minimums at the official English language requirements page.
  • Documentation: Transcripts, bachelor’s certificate, statement of purpose, two references, and CV. WES verification is not routinely required for Dundee.

UG Requirements

  • Academic: Class 12 from CBSE, ISC, or a recognised state board with 65% minimum; English Core 70% for standard courses or 80% for higher-English programmes such as Law.
  • English proficiency: IELTS 6.0 to 6.5 overall depending on course; TOEFL iBT, PTE Academic UKVI, and Cambridge C1/C2 are accepted alternates.

Accepted English Tests

  • IELTS Academic UKVI (preferred), Pearson PTE Academic UKVI, Trinity ISE, LanguageCert SELT UKVI.
  • Non-UKVI: IELTS Academic, PTE Academic, Cambridge C1 Advanced, Cambridge C2 Proficiency, ETS TOEFL iBT (single-sitting scores only, MyBest not accepted).
  • Online: IELTS Online, TOEFL Home Edition, Oxford ELLT Digital, Kaplan Test of English.
  • Pre-sessional English courses are offered where scores fall short.

Note: Dundee accepts English-medium bachelor’s degrees from Indian universities as an IELTS waiver on a case-by-case basis, provided the medium is confirmed in writing by the awarding institution and the degree was completed within the last two years.


University of Dundee Acceptance Rate 2027

University of Dundee has an overall acceptance rate of 36% to 45% (estimated), placing it in the moderately selective band among UK universities. The university does not publish an official figure, so this range is derived from third-party admissions data and is directional rather than exact.

YearAcceptance RateTrend
202636% to 45% (estimated)Stable
202540% (estimated)Stable

The rate for international applicants is materially higher than the overall figure, and Dundee actively encourages Indian applications for its MSc business, computing, and life sciences streams. Medicine and Dentistry sit far below the headline rate, with typical single-digit acceptance rates for international UG applicants.

Reality check: A 40% headline rate does not translate to easy Medicine or Dentistry entry for Indian applicants; competitive UG routes still require Class 12 scores above 80% with UCAT or GAMSAT depending on programme.

Monthly Cost of Living in Dundee for Indian Students

Dundee is one of the more affordable UK student cities and materially cheaper than London or Edinburgh.

ExpenseMonthly (GBP)Monthly (INR)
Accommodation (university halls or shared flat)716 to 95693,080 to 1,24,280
Food and groceries25032,500
Utilities (gas, electricity, internet)15019,500
Transportation (student bus pass)486,240
Books and equipment455,850
Personal, social, and clothing18023,400
Total monthly1,389 to 1,6291.81 to 2.12 lakh
Annual (12 months)16,668 to 19,54821.67 to 25.41 lakh

[Source: University of Dundee official cost estimate]

Students under 22 travel free on Scottish buses, and full-time students are exempt from council tax, both of which meaningfully lower the effective monthly outlay for Indian students.

Insider note: Real Dundee rent for Indian students sits closer to GBP 179 to 239 per week in university halls, and off-campus rooms in Hawkhill or West End typically clear GBP 500 to 650 per month, well below the equivalent bracket in London or Edinburgh.

University of Dundee Campus, Facilities and Student Life

Dundee University runs a compact single-site City Campus in central Dundee on the north bank of the Firth of Tay, within walking distance of the railway station and city centre.

  • Location and transport: Ten minutes on foot from Dundee railway station; direct trains to Edinburgh in 75 minutes and Glasgow in 90 minutes.
  • Housing: Over 1,600 rooms across five residences, with a guarantee for first-year international students who apply by the accommodation deadline.
  • Notable facilities: Duncan of Jordanstone College of Art and Design, the Life Sciences research complex, and a dedicated Institute for Sport and Exercise.
  • Indian community: A large and active Indian Society, regular Diwali and Holi events, and Indian grocery shops in the city centre.

What Indian students say: Indian students consistently highlight Dundee’s low cost of living relative to other UK cities, the walkable campus, and personal access to teaching staff for research and dissertation supervision.


University of Dundee Scholarships 2027

Dundee University confirms multiple partial-fee scholarships for Indian postgraduate applicants, layered on tuition, with no fully funded routes offered by the university.

ScholarshipTypeAward ValueEligibilityDeadline
GREAT Scholarship 2026/27Partial tuitionGBP 10,000 (INR 13 lakh)Indian nationals joining a one-year taught mastersVerify at official page
Vice Chancellor’s South Asia ScholarshipPartial tuition, multi-yearGBP 6,500 year one + GBP 4,000 in each subsequent year, up to GBP 22,500 total (INR 29.25 lakh)South Asian undergraduate and postgraduate applicantsVerify at official page
Global Excellence ScholarshipPartial tuitionGBP 5,000 (INR 6.50 lakh) (estimated)Indian postgraduate applicants meeting academic merit criteriaVerify at official page
School-specific merit awardsPartial tuitionGBP 1,500 to GBP 5,000 (INR 1.95 to 6.50 lakh)Varies by school and programmeVerify at official page

Planning note: The GREAT Scholarship and Vice Chancellor’s South Asia Scholarship cannot be combined at full value, so Indian applicants should model both awards separately before choosing which to accept.

University of Dundee Rankings 2027

Dundee University’s strongest current placement is #75 globally for SDG 3 Good Health and Wellbeing in the THE Impact Rankings 2025, alongside a stable QS World Rank in the #418 to #447 band across the last three editions.

Ranking BodyLatest EditionPrevious EditionTwo Editions Back
QS World2027: #4472026: #4282025: #418
THE World2026: #301-3502025: #301-3502024: #301-350
ARWU Shanghai2025: #301-4002024: #401-5002023: #401-500
Collegedunia Study Abroad2026: #298 global, #42 UKNANA

[Source: QS, THE, ARWU, Collegedunia Study Abroad]

By subject, Dundee ranks in the QS #51-100 band for Dentistry and holds top-100 THE positions for Life Sciences (#101-125) and Medical Health (#176-200). Collegedunia Study Abroad ranks Dundee #105 globally and #23 in the UK for Medicine, and #148 globally for Law.

Key insight: All Dundee rankings sit comfortably above the QS Top 500 cutoff most Indian employers use as a shortlisting filter, and the university’s Impact Ranking #75 for health is a distinct signal for Indian applicants applying to public-health, dentistry, or clinical routes.

University of Dundee FAQs

Ques. What English-taught masters programmes does University of Dundee offer Indian students?

Ans. All Dundee University taught masters run in English, spanning MSc Management, MSc Business Analytics, MSc International Business, MSc Data Science, MSc Computing, MSc Renewable Energy, MPH Public Health, LLM International Law, and clinical MScs in medical fields. Indian applicants can pick between September and January intakes for selected masters, with programme-specific January availability listed on each course page.

Ques. Can Indian students work part-time during their studies at Dundee University?

Ans. Yes. Indian students on a UK Student visa can work up to 20 hours per week during term time and full-time during vacations, following UKVI rules. Dundee’s Careers Service maintains a live campus and city job board, and typical part-time rates in Dundee sit between GBP 11.50 to 13.00 per hour (INR 1,495 to 1,690).

Ques. Does University of Dundee offer an IELTS waiver for Indian applicants?

Ans. Dundee considers IELTS waivers case by case for Indian applicants who completed an English-medium bachelor’s degree within the last two years, provided the awarding institution issues a signed medium-of-instruction letter. Standardised alternatives include TOEFL iBT, PTE Academic UKVI, Cambridge C1 or C2, Trinity ISE, and LanguageCert SELT UKVI.

Ques. Is a GRE or GMAT required for University of Dundee MSc programmes?

Ans. No. Dundee University does not require GRE or GMAT for any of its taught MSc programmes, including MSc Business Analytics, MSc Finance, and MSc Management. This makes the application significantly cheaper and faster than US masters routes for Indian applicants, and admission decisions rest on the bachelor’s transcript, references, statement of purpose, and English proficiency.

Ques. What is the application fee at University of Dundee for Indian students?

Ans. Postgraduate taught applications through the Dundee direct portal carry no application fee for most programmes, unlike UCAS-routed UK undergraduate applications which currently cost GBP 28.50 (INR 3,705). Indian applicants should still budget a GBP 5,000 (INR 6.50 lakh) minimum tuition deposit before CAS is issued, plus separate UKVI visa and IHS charges.

Ques. Which Indian education loan providers recognise University of Dundee?

Ans. Dundee University appears on the approved-university lists of leading Indian loan providers including SBI Global Ed-Vantage, HDFC Credila, Avanse, InCred, and Auxilo, and typically qualifies for unsecured loans up to INR 40 lakh and secured loans up to INR 75 lakh. Applicants should provide the Dundee CAS letter and offer letter as loan-processing anchors.

Ques. Can Indian students bring dependents on a Dundee University Student visa?

Ans. Dependent visas are restricted under current UKVI rules: Indian PGT masters students cannot bring dependents. Only research postgraduate students on courses of 9 months or longer, and government-sponsored students, remain eligible to bring a spouse or children. Indian applicants planning family travel should target Dundee PhD or research-masters routes.

Ques. Does Dundee University require WES verification for Indian bachelor’s transcripts?

Ans. No. University of Dundee accepts Indian bachelor’s transcripts directly from recognised universities without WES or ECE verification, in contrast to typical US and Canadian requirements. Applicants must upload scanned transcripts and mark sheets in the Dundee direct portal, and provide certified originals at CAS-issuance stage. Apostille is not required for admission but may be required for the UK Student visa depending on the applicant’s UKVI category.
